Repurpose Old Jars for Candle Holders


Upcycle those old jars cluttering your kitchen and transform them into festive candle holders that add warmth to your fall porch!
You’ll impress your neighbors with your eco-friendly decor, plus it’s a fun way to show off your crafty side.
- Grab some twine for that rustic charm.
- Use paints for a splash of color (hello, pumpkins!).
- Fill them with colorful leaves or acorns—nature’s confetti!
- Drop in a tea light for an enchanting glow.
- Add a sprinkle of cinnamon—smell that autumn magic?

How Can I Preserve My Pumpkins Longer?
To preserve your pumpkins longer, try these pumpkin preservation tips: mix water with a little bleach for a DIY pumpkin spray. It’ll keep them fresh, and hey, they won’t rot before your spooky fun!
What Materials Should I Avoid for Outdoor Fall Decor?
Avoid using flimsy recycled materials, like cardboard or paper, for your outdoor fall decor. Instead, opt for weatherproof options that won’t turn into soggy ghosts after one rain—a decorating nightmare no one wants!
